stage 2 kit
09 klx250s...i put a fmf q4 slip on and a stock 127.5 jet and took off the snorkle.....it's still running lean and takes an hour to warm up and run decent...i ordered the klx300 stage 2 jet kit...i'm going to put the 128 jet in it and the needle on the second clip up. Any advice?
#2
Put in a 127.5 stock jet?
Somethings goofy here, a 2206 stage II dyno jet kit comes with a 120, 124, 128 and a 132 jet. The bike should run just fine with a 124 or a 128 jet with your mods. Since you said you removed the snorkel, I would start with a 128 on like the 3rd or 4th clip on the needle.
Did you remove the fuel mixture plug? And adjust the fuel screw? If not, this could be your problem. Also, even with my jet kit, when it is like 35 degrees out, my bike takes a bit to get warm. Don't know if weather is a factor where you are at.

A Thermo-Bob fixes the long warm-up times. My bike warms sufficiently to run fine within minutes. It's a VERY over-built cooling system, and it works too effectively to keep the coolant at a decent, warm temp, if the air temp is cool or cold.

My SF was running rough since the temp. has dropped around here. I run a FMF Q4 with a high flow air filter and the air box lid removed. I also have the DJ kit installed. I was running a 128 but when the temps drops it was needing choked to start and it was choking while running at 60mph. So I swapped out the 128 for the 134 and we will see what happens.
